Llandudno continued there winning streak at Maesdu Road, with a performance
well below there recent form,but still managed to overcome the visitors
Dolgellau. Within three minutes of the kick off they were three points ahead
from a Ryan Pike penalty. The visitors hit back almost immediately with two
quick penalty conversions,but then Llan began to find some form,when from a
scrum close to the visitors try line,that young scrum half Byron Davies touched
down for the first try.The visitors completed there points scoring with another
penalty conversion just before the half time whistle. Llan now managed to put
there game together,pinning the visitors back inside of there own half,and it
was prop John Stokes who was next one to touch down for a converted try by Ryan
Pike. Llan continued to dominate proceedings,and it was Man of the Match Morgan
Owen that touched down for an unconverted try,with Ed Weston scoring the final
try which gained them maximum match points,with Ryan adding two more points
from the conversion. Next Match away to Bethesda 24th March KO 2.30. Match
